Subject: [Buildroot] [git commit] Revert "auto{conf, make}: only make available on archs supported by qemu"

Since perl no longer requires host-qemu, autoconf and automake work
again on the architectures that are not supported by host-qemu.
This reverts commit c65d92e8e2767b09aaee6b717cbd9b66f88ea39c.

diff --git a/package/autoconf/Config.in b/package/autoconf/Config.in
index c304572..5f2f148 100644
--- a/package/autoconf/Config.in
+++ b/package/autoconf/Config.in
@@ -1,12 +1,8 @@
config BR2_PACKAGE_AUTOCONF
bool "autoconf"
- depends on !(BR2_avr32 || BR2_bfin || BR2_sh2 || BR2_sh2a || BR2_sh3 || BR2_sh3eb || BR2_sh64)
select BR2_PACKAGE_PERL
help
Extensible program for developing configure scripts. These
scripts handle all the mundane system/feature detection.
http://www.gnu.org/software/autoconf/
-
-comment "autoconf requires an architecture supported by qemu"
- depends on BR2_avr32 || BR2_bfin || BR2_sh2 || BR2_sh2a || BR2_sh3 || BR2_sh3eb || BR2_sh64
diff --git a/package/automake/Config.in b/package/automake/Config.in
index f8d74ef..9a9673a 100644
--- a/package/automake/Config.in
+++ b/package/automake/Config.in
@@ -1,6 +1,5 @@
config BR2_PACKAGE_AUTOMAKE
bool "automake"
- depends on !(BR2_avr32 || BR2_bfin || BR2_sh2 || BR2_sh2a || BR2_sh3 || BR2_sh3eb || BR2_sh64)
select BR2_PACKAGE_AUTOCONF
select BR2_PACKAGE_PERL
help
@@ -8,6 +7,3 @@ config BR2_PACKAGE_AUTOMAKE
configure scripts (made by autoconf).
http://www.gnu.org/software/automake/
-
-comment "automake requires an architecture supported by qemu"
- depends on BR2_avr32 || BR2_bfin || BR2_sh2 || BR2_sh2a || BR2_sh3 || BR2_sh3eb || BR2_sh64
